服务器如何实现cdn

服务器实现CDN需要使用CDN服务,将静态资源缓存到CDN节点,通过CDN节点提供访问。
服务器如何实现cdn

【服务器如何实现CDN】

CDN(Content Delivery Network)是一种通过在多个地理位置部署服务器,将网站内容缓存到离用户最近的服务器上,以提高网站访问速度和性能的技术,下面将详细介绍服务器如何实现CDN。

1、选择合适的CDN服务提供商:

需要选择一个可靠的CDN服务提供商,如阿里云、腾讯云等,这些提供商通常在全球范围内拥有大量的服务器节点,可以提供高速稳定的服务。

2、注册并配置CDN服务:

服务器如何实现cdn

在选定的CDN服务提供商网站上注册账号,并购买相应的CDN服务套餐。

登录管理控制台,创建一个新的域名或选择已有的域名,然后将其与CDN服务关联起来。

在域名管理页面中,设置CNAME记录,将域名解析指向CDN服务提供商提供的DNS服务器地址。

3、配置CDN缓存规则:

在CDN管理控制台中,选择要配置的域名,进入域名管理页面。

服务器如何实现cdn

点击“缓存规则”选项卡,然后点击“添加规则”按钮。

根据需要设置缓存规则,例如根据文件类型、URL路径等进行缓存。

还可以设置缓存时间、过期时间等参数,以满足不同的需求。

4、上传网站内容到CDN服务器:

使用FTP工具或Web界面,将网站的内容上传到CDN服务提供商提供的服务器上。

可以根据需要将不同类型的文件上传到不同的文件夹中,以便更好地管理和组织内容。

5、测试CDN效果:

完成上述步骤后,可以通过浏览器访问网站,检查是否使用了CDN服务。

可以使用一些在线工具来测试网站的加载速度和性能,以评估CDN的效果。

6、监控和优化CDN服务:

CDN服务提供商通常会提供一些监控工具,用于实时监测CDN服务的运行状态和性能指标。

可以使用这些工具来查看带宽使用情况、命中率、响应时间等数据,并根据需要进行优化调整。

7、处理CDN故障和回源:

如果CDN服务器出现故障或无法正常提供服务,CDN服务提供商会尽快修复问题。

如果某个资源无法从CDN服务器获取,可以通过设置回源策略,让请求直接返回源站服务器上的资源。

8、定期备份和更新CDN服务器:

CDN服务提供商通常会定期备份服务器上的数据,以防止数据丢失或损坏。

也需要定期更新服务器上的软件和配置文件,以确保服务器的安全性和稳定性。

9、安全保护CDN服务器:

CDN服务器通常具有较高的安全性,但仍然需要采取一些措施来保护服务器免受攻击和恶意行为的影响。

可以使用防火墙、入侵检测系统等安全设备来保护服务器的安全。

还需要定期更新服务器上的软件和补丁,以修复已知的安全漏洞。

10、优化CDN性能:

CDN的性能优化是一个持续的过程,需要根据实际情况进行调整和优化。

可以根据用户的地理位置、网络环境等因素,动态调整CDN服务器的选择和缓存策略。

还可以使用一些性能优化技术,如HTTP/2、压缩算法等,来提高网站的加载速度和性能。

【与本文相关的问题】

1、CDN服务提供商有哪些?如何选择适合自己的CDN服务提供商?

答:常见的CDN服务提供商有阿里云、腾讯云、亚马逊AWS等,选择适合自己的CDN服务提供商需要考虑以下因素:服务质量、覆盖范围、价格、技术支持等,可以通过比较不同提供商的服务特点和用户评价来做出选择。

2、CDN缓存规则的配置有哪些注意事项?

答:在配置CDN缓存规则时,需要注意以下几点:

根据实际需求合理设置缓存规则,避免不必要的缓存冲突和错误。

根据文件类型、URL路径等进行合理的分类和分组,以便更好地管理和组织内容。

注意设置合适的缓存时间和过期时间,以保证内容的及时更新和刷新。

根据需要设置回源策略,确保在某些情况下能够直接从源站获取资源。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/452921.html

(0)
K-seoK-seoSEO优化员
上一篇 2024年5月2日 04:17
下一篇 2024年5月2日 04:20

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入